Alphaville, Barueri (Portuguese pronunciation:) is an affluent district split between the municipalities of Barueri and Santana de Parnaíba metropolitan region of São Paulo. The Alphaville district is a real estate and gated community development in Brazil, constituted by a number of business and residential condominium .

A transit hotel is a short-stay hotel that is situated in the transit zone of international airports, where passengers on extended waits between planes (typically a minimum of six hours) can stay while waiting for their next flight. The hotel is within the airside security/passport checkpoints and close to the airport terminals. [1]
